AC blowing warm air, weak airflow, frequent cycling, uneven cooling, or unusual noises can have several causes. Describe what you are noticing and when it started so the next step can be discussed. A system that will not turn on also needs an equipment-specific assessment; the symptom alone does not identify the problem.

Request serviceIf a furnace is not warming your home consistently or behaves differently than usual, an equipment assessment can help determine what needs attention. Do not open fuel lines, bypass safety switches, or attempt ignition repairs. If you smell gas or a carbon monoxide alarm sounds, leave immediately and contact emergency services or your gas utility from outside.

Request serviceUneven comfort may involve filters, vents, thermostat placement, ductwork, or system operation. Make sure accessible supply and return vents are not blocked by furniture and follow the equipment manual for filter care. Persistent weak airflow or room-to-room temperature differences merit further assessment rather than a diagnosis based on symptoms alone.

Link to this answerCheck that the thermostat is set to cooling and to a temperature below the room temperature. Check your filter according to the equipment manual and make sure accessible vents are not blocked. If the problem continues, or you notice ice or unusual sounds, stop using the system and ask for an assessment. Do not open electrical panels or handle refrigerant.
Link to this answerWarm air can have several causes, including thermostat settings, restricted airflow, or an equipment issue. The symptom alone does not confirm a diagnosis. Note when it happens and whether the outdoor unit is running, then call to discuss an assessment.

Link to this answerChanges such as weak airflow, uneven temperatures, frequent cycling, a system that will not start, new noises, or unexpected increases in energy use may warrant an assessment. These signs do not identify a specific fault on their own.
Link to this answerYes. Incorrect settings, depleted batteries on battery-powered models, or a control problem can affect operation. Follow your thermostat manual for basic checks. Compatibility and wiring should be assessed before replacing the thermostat.

Link to this answerNew grinding, banging, or loud buzzing sounds are reasons to stop using the system and request an assessment. Do not reach into moving equipment or open electrical panels. If there is smoke, a burning smell, a gas odor, or immediate danger, leave the property and contact emergency services from a safe location.
